Understanding Medical Claims
A medical claim is a request for payment that a healthcare provider submits to a payer, such as an insurance company or Medicare. The claim includes details such as diagnosis codes, procedure codes, and patient facts. Understanding the elements that comprise a medical claim is the first step toward becoming a triumphant billing specialist.
types of Medical Claims
- Institutional Claims: Used by healthcare facilities like hospitals.
- Professional Claims: Typically submitted by individual healthcare providers.
- Dental Claims: Specifically for dental procedures and services.
Essential Skills for Billing Specialists
To excel in the field of medical billing, certain skills are indispensable. Hear are a few key competencies that every billing specialist should develop:
1. Attention to Detail
Errors in coding or billing can lead to claim denials. Being meticulous helps prevent costly mistakes.
2. Understanding of Medical Terminology
A solid grasp of medical terminology enables billing specialists to understand the services being billed accurately.
3.Proficiency in Coding
Coding knowledge is critical.Familiarity with ICD-10, CPT, and HCPCS codes is a must for submitting accurate claims.
4.Knowledge of Regulations
Billing specialists should stay informed on healthcare regulations, including HIPAA and the Affordable Care Act, to ensure compliance.

Practical Tips for Aspiring Billing Specialists
Here are some practical tips to help you succeed in mastering medical claims:
1. Obtain Certification
Certifications such as Certified Professional Coder (CPC) or Certified Billing and Coding Specialist (CBCS) can enhance job prospects.
2. Stay Updated
Healthcare policies can change frequently. Regularly read industry publications and attend workshops.
3. Network with Professionals
Join professional organizations like the American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C) for networking opportunities.
Case Study: Overcoming Denials
Consider a scenario where a billing specialist encounters a high volume of denied claims due to coding errors.By re-evaluating the processes in place, they implement a thorough review system that includes:
- Regular audits of submitted claims.
- Training sessions for staff on coding best practices.
- Creating a checklist to ensure completeness before submitting claims.
As a result,the practice saw a substantial decrease in denials,improving both revenue and efficiency.
